1995 SESSION
SB 776 Retirement benefits for state employees.
Introduced by: Walter A. Stosch | all patrons ... notes | add to my profiles
SUMMARY:
Virginia Retirement System; retirement benefits for certain members. Allows members of the Virginia Retirement System and the State Police Officers' Retirement System who are age 50 and have at least ten years of service to retire and start collecting a retirement allowance. The allowance is based on the larger of the present value of the benefits the member would have received had he deferred collecting benefits until reaching age 55 or the accumulated member contributions and interest. This option will be available to anyone who met the eligibility criteria on January 1, 1994. Members taking retirement under this option must agree not to work for the state for two years following retirement. State employees will also be able to elect a joint and survivor option, under which the payment stream will be based on the life expectancies of both the member and the contingent beneficiary. The VRS is required to begin administering this program by May 1, 1995. The bill has an emergency clause.
